PCTAIRE-2 inhibitors represent a class of chemical compounds designed to specifically target and inhibit the activity of the protein kinase PCTAIRE-2 (also known as CDK16). PCTAIRE-2 is a member of the cyclin-dependent kinase (CDK) family, which plays a crucial role in regulating the cell cycle and various cellular processes such as cell division, transcription, and differentiation. PCTAIRE-2, in particular, is known to be involved in neuronal development, making it a significant target in neuroscience research.
PCTAIRE-2 inhibitors are designed to bind to the active site of the PCTAIRE-2 enzyme, disrupting its ability to phosphorylate target proteins and therefore impeding its normal cellular functions. This targeted inhibition can have a profound impact on cellular processes influenced by PCTAIRE-2, potentially leading to insights into the molecular mechanisms underlying neurological disorders and other conditions where PCTAIRE-2 is implicated. Researchers have been exploring the development and application of PCTAIRE-2 inhibitors as valuable tools in the laboratory to study cell signaling pathways, with the ultimate aim of better understanding the physiological and pathological processes governed by this kinase. By elucidating the role of PCTAIRE-2 in various cellular contexts, these inhibitors have the potential to contribute significantly to our knowledge of cell biology.
